Output 50d895d334c5ccda372d184d72db91cc076484868c8d09323f85d08bb9faf2ca:1

value
908590
script pubkey
OP_0 OP_PUSHBYTES_20 f07f31850eef19ed4137ab3062cfe1bd093547fa
address
bc1q7plnrpgwauv76sfh4vcx9nlph5yn23l6htduka
transaction
50d895d334c5ccda372d184d72db91cc076484868c8d09323f85d08bb9faf2ca
confirmations
22693
spent
true